Which of the following is not true of the respiratory pump?

A) It is a mechanism that helps with venous return to the heart.
B) Contraction of the diaphragm causes an increase in the volume of the thoracic cavity, and a decrease in pressure.
C) Increased venous return to the heart causes the heart rate to increase.
D) More blood enters the heart during expiration than inspiration.
E) All of these are true of the respiratory pump.

Respiratory Pump

A mechanism involving the muscles of the thorax and abdomen, which helps in moving air in and out of the lungs during breathing.

Diaphragm

a large, dome-shaped muscle located at the base of the lungs that plays a crucial role in breathing.

Venous Return

The flow of blood back to the heart through the veins, crucial for maintaining cardiovascular circulation.

The statement "More blood enters the heart during expiration than inspiration" is not true. During inspiration, the decrease in thoracic pressure creates a vacuum that helps draw blood back to the heart, resulting in increased venous return. Therefore, more blood enters the heart during inspiration than expiration.
